Montreal?. They only vote two ways the Liberal Party which is the urban vote and the Bloc Quebecois which is the suburban vote, in most of these riding the conservative are placed at third or fourth place. The conservative party has a better shot at winning the Atlantic provinces because in these ridings the conservatives are placed at second or first place, the party should just focus their efforts at the maritimes rather than in Montreal.

In order to do this the conservatives need to show itself as the party of blue collar workers that only taxes the rich so we can afford tax cuts for the middle and working class. This appeals to the maritimers and GTA voters who favour government intervention and it also doesn't alienate westerners who are mostly farmers and O&G workers who fit in the blue collar type.
